Dr. Jerry Williams Book Sale

The Dr. Jerry Williams Memorial Book sale, sponsored by the Kiwanis Club of Winnfield, has been extended until Thursday, April 2, 2026. This sale features the personal library collection of Dr. Williams, comprising over 2,000 books. The collection contains many mystery novels by Lee Child, James Patterson, Stuart Woods, and other bestselling authors. Also featured are rare children's titles, WWII and Civil War history, and Louisiana history books. The Kiwanis Club encourages the community to check out this unique collection! All proceeds from this sale will be donated to the Winn Parish Library, where Dr. Williams served as Library Board President until his passing.
